Guatemaya Deli and Restaurant has a thin inspection record, with only two visits on file so far. The most recent report on file is from Sep 15, 2025. Low risk indicates the latest report didn't flag anything that would worry the average customer.

Recent inspections have found fewer violations than earlier ones, averaging around one violation lately and about five violations before that.

Looking across the full record, “non-food contact surface or equipment made of unacceptable material” is the recurring theme, flagged two times.

That puts the facility ahead of the local pack: the average Brooklyn restaurant scores 77. The full picture is one of consistent compliance.
